(2020·河南柘城·九年级期末)Everyone can feel stressed out because of too many
things happening in your life. Teenagers,how-ever, have 11 opportunities to get stressed
than people in any other age group. Being a teenager is hard.
You are not a child any more, but you are not 12 ,even though you have to deal with
some grown-up problems and make decisions by 13 . Families can be one of the biggest
causes of stress, such as problems of arguing with 14 or brothers or sisters. Teenagers also
have lots of stress from 15 ,either from their teachers or from their classmates. Some
teenagers also feel 16 about choosing their education after high school. Getting a place at
university can be very dif-ficult and some can't 17 to go to university. It is hard for some
teenagers to get a job after they graduate. There are so many young people finishing school
18 not enough jobs for them. Though there is a lot of stress, you can find many ways to 19
it. Talking to people is one of the best ways to deal with stress. It may sound 20 ,but it is
helpful.

(2021·南昌·九年级期末)Think your school rules are boring? Take a look at these rules.
No hugging
Some schools in Portland and Florida started the rule — no
hugging in 2010. Two years later some schools in New
Jerseyand Brooklyn made the same rule. The reason is clear —
to avoid “unsuitable interactions (不适当的互动)” between
students.
No bags into the
classroom
One high school in Michigan doesn’t allow bags into the
classroom at all. The school asks students to return to their
lockers (有锁存物柜) between classes for their books in order
to make sure they are safe in lunchrooms and classrooms.
No Ugg boots (Ugg 靴
子)
It might get very cold in winter in Pennsylvania, but students
there aren’t allowed to wear their Ugg boots into class. It’s to
stop them from hiding things like mobile phones in the boots.
No balls
A Toronto school doesn’t allow its students to bring any hard
balls to school. Why? A parent was taken to hospital with a
concussion (脑震荡) after being hit by a ball.
